A propriedade Number.prototype representa o protótipo (prototype) para o constructor de Number.

Property attributes of Number.prototype
Writable no
Enumerable no
Configurable no

Descrição

Todas as instâncias de Number herdam de Number.prototype. O objecto protótipo (prototype) do constructor de Number pode ser modificado para afectar todas as instâncias de Number.

Propriedades

Number.prototype.constructor
Retorna a função criadora das instâncias deste objecto. Por predifinição este é o objecto Number.

Métodos

Number.prototype.toExponential()
Retorna uma representação em string do número em notação científica.
Number.prototype.toFixed()
Retorna uma representação em string do número em notação de ponto fixo.
Number.prototype.toLocaleString()
Retorna uma string do número numa representação sensível à linguagem. Faz override do método Object.prototype.toLocaleString().
Number.prototype.toPrecision()
Retorna uma representação em string do número numa precisão especificada em ponto fixo ou notação científica.
Number.prototype.toSource()
Retorna um objecto literal representando o objecto Number especificado; podes usar este valor para criar um novo objecto. Faz override ao método Object.prototype.toSource().
Number.prototype.toString()
Retorna uma representação em string do objecto especificado na base especificada. Faz override ao método Object.prototype.toString().
Number.prototype.valueOf()
Retorna o valor primitivo do objecto especificado. Faz override ao método Object.prototype.valueOf().

Especificações

Especificação Estado Comentário
ECMAScript 1st Edition (ECMA-262) Standard Definição Inicial. Implementado em  JavaScript 1.1.
ECMAScript 5.1 (ECMA-262)
The definition of 'Number' in that specification.
Standard  
ECMAScript 2015 (6th Edition, ECMA-262)
The definition of 'Number' in that specification.
Standard  

Compatibilidade dos browsers

We're converting our compatibility data into a machine-readable JSON format. This compatibility table still uses the old format, because we haven't yet converted the data it contains. Find out how you can help!

Funcionalidade Chrome Firefox (Gecko) Internet Explorer Opera Safari
Suporte básico (Yes) (Yes) (Yes) (Yes) (Yes)
Funcionalidade Android Chrome para Android Firefox Mobile (Gecko) IE Mobile Opera Mobile Safari Mobile
Suporte básico (Yes) (Yes) (Yes) (Yes) (Yes) (Yes)

Ver também

Etiquetas do documento e contribuidores

Contribuidores para esta página: Redeagle48
Última atualização por: Redeagle48,